抄録

In order to investigate on particulate matter emission and generation by the traffic of heavy-duty vehicles on roads, total suspended particulate matter (TSP) were collected at the roadside along major local-road Urawa-Tokorosawa with high-volume air samplers during September 14∼16 and November 30∼December 5, 1992. Concentration of tire-dust in TSP was determined by a method based on the determination of thiophene derivatives generated by the pyrolysis of TSP. During the latter sampling period, ambient concentrations of tire-dust generated by the traffic of heavy-duty vehicles and passenger cars were 1.8∼5.9 and 2.7∼6.0 μgm-3, respectively. These results suggest that 3-methylthiophene be a suitable indicator of TSP emitted and generated from heavy-duty vehicles, because it is a specific pyrolyzate from tire-dust for trucks and buses. Concentration of elemental carbon (EC), most of which could be emitted by diesel-powered vehicles. Contributions of total tire-dust by heavy-duty vehicles and passenger cars to TSP and EC concentration were ca. 4 and ca. 20%, respectively.
